//-------------------------------------------------------------------------
        public virtual void test_methods()
        {
            TradedPrice test = sut();

            assertEquals(test.TradeDate, DATE);
            assertEquals(test.Price, PRICE);
        }
        public virtual void coverage()
        {
            TradedPrice test = sut();

            coverImmutableBean(test);
            TradedPrice test2 = TradedPrice.of(DATE.plusDays(1), PRICE + 1d);

            coverBeanEquals(test, test2);
        }
Ejemplo n.º 3
0
 //-----------------------------------------------------------------------
 public override bool Equals(object obj)
 {
     if (obj == this)
     {
         return(true);
     }
     if (obj != null && obj.GetType() == this.GetType())
     {
         TradedPrice other = (TradedPrice)obj;
         return(JodaBeanUtils.equal(tradeDate, other.tradeDate) && JodaBeanUtils.equal(price, other.price));
     }
     return(false);
 }
 //-------------------------------------------------------------------------
 internal static TradedPrice sut()
 {
     return(TradedPrice.of(DATE, PRICE));
 }